WebThe inflammation that comes with psoriatic arthritis can also lead to a condition known as interstitial lung disease. Symptoms include shortness of breath, coughing, and fatigue. 13. WebJun 25, 2024 · The inflammation seen in psoriatic arthritis can damage the airways and lungs. Conditions such as asthma, sarcoidosis, interstitial lung disease, COPD, and lung cancer occur more often in people with psoriatic arthritis. WebSep 19, 2024 · A 2016 study 10  in JAMA Dermatology concluded that psoriasis, as an independent risk factor, increased the risk of the following cancers compared to the general population: Lymphoma (all types): 34% Lung cancer: 15% Non-melanoma skin cancer: 12% WebThis can lead to atherosclerosis — the buildup of fats, cholesterol and cellular debris within blood vessel walls. Known as plaques, these fatty deposits narrow arteries, raising blood pressure and reducing the flow of blood to the heart and other organs. Some unstable plaques can rupture, triggering a clot that may cause a heart attack or stroke.
